Two 437th Maintenance Squadron crew chiefs work on the front gear of a C-17 Globemaster III while the aircraft is lifted off the ground using jacks Oct. 7, 2013, at Joint Base Charleston, S.C. A team of eight crew chiefs used six jacks to raise a C-17 Globemaster III off the ground to change a tire and inspect the gears. (U.S. Air Force photo/Senior Airman Dennis Sloan)
